Precision, 4-Channel, Low-Level,
Differential Multiplexer
The Intersil HI-539 is a monolithic, 4-Channel, differential
multiplexer. Two digital inputs are provided for channel
selection, plus an Enable input to disconnect all channels.
Performance is guaranteed for each channel over the
voltage range ±10V, but is optimized for low level differential
signals. Leakage current, for example, which varies slightly
with input voltage, has its distribution centered at zero input
volts.
In most monolithic multiplexers, the net differential offset due
to thermal effects becomes significant for low level signals.
This problem is minimized in the HI-539 by symmetrical
placement of critical circuitry with respect to the few heat
producing devices.
Supply voltages are ±15V and power consumption is only
2.5mW.

Features
• Differential Performance, Typical:
- Low ∆rON, 125oC . . . . . . . . . . . . . . . . . . . . . . . . . . 5.5Ω
- Low ∆ID(ON), 125oC . . . . . . . . . . . . . . . . . . . . . . . 0.6nA
- Low ∆ Charge Injection . . . . . . . . . . . . . . . . . . . . 0.1pC
- Low Crosstalk . . . . . . . . . . . . . . . . . . . . . . . . . . . -124dB
• Settling Time, ±0.01% . . . . . . . . . . . . . . . . . . . . . . . 900ns
• Wide Supply Range . . . . . . . . . . . . . . . . . . . ±5V to ±18V
• Break-Before-Make Switching
• No Latch-Up
Applications
• Low Level Data Acquisition
• Precision Instrumentation
• Test Systems
